About Pawapuri Pawapuri Travel Guide
Pawapuri, located in the Indian state of Bihar, holds immense historical and cultural significance. It is famous for being the place where Lord Mahavira, the 24th Tirthankara of Jainism, attained nirvana. The town is a pilgrimage site for Jains and attracts visitors from around the world who seek spiritual enlightenment and tranquility.

Important Pawapuri trip information
- Ideal Duration: 1-2 days
- Best Time to Visit: October to March
- Nearby Airports and Railway Stations: The nearest airport is in Patna, and the nearest railway station is in Rajgir.
